CITY OF RONCEVERTE
NOTICE OF PUBLIC HEARING:
The Ronceverte City Council will conduct a public hearing (and second reading) on Monday, November 7, 2016, at 7:00 p.m. at the Ronceverte City Hall, 182 Main Street West, Ronceverte, West Virginia, to enact Section 5C-1-24 of Chapter 5C, Ordinance 2016-04, of the Code of the City of Ronceverte, West Virginia, to provide a Vacant Structure Code. WV Code §8-12-16c gives the governing body of a municipality the authority to establish by ordinance a vacant building and property registration and maintenance program.
Interested parties may comment at such time and written comments are also welcome in advance directed to the City of Ronceverte, City Administrator, P.O. Box 417, Ronceverte, WV  24970.
A building or structure shall be deemed “vacant” if no person or persons actually, currently conducts a lawfully licensed business, or lawfully resides, dwells, or lives in any part of the building as the legal or equitable owner(s) or owner-occupant(s), or tenant(s) or tenant-occupant(s), on a permanent, non-transient basis. A building or structure shall not be deemed “vacant” and subject to the registration, the registration fee, and possible penalty provisions provided herein if (i) the exterior maintenance and major systems of the building and the surrounding real property thereof are not in violation of any building codes or health and sanitation codes; and (ii) there is proof that all essential utility services, including, but not limited to, electric, gas, heating, water and sewer services are active, uninterrupted, and capable of being used without any action being taken by any utility company. In order for the utility services to be considered active and uninterrupted as described in this ordinance, the utility services must be more than merely registered to the owner for purposes of billing and must be utilized, at a minimum, in order to keep the property and the major systems of the building in compliance with building and safety codes. The person or entity asserting that there has been active and uninterrupted utility service has the burden to produce actual bills evidencing utility service for the relevant period.
Owners of vacant buildings shall register such vacant buildings with the City, make payment of a fee for the registration thereof as set forth herein, and otherwise conform to the requirements of this Vacant Structure Code. There shall be an annual registration fee for each vacant structure subject to registration in the vacant structure registry.
(a)     No fee for a property that has been on the vacant structure registry for less than one year;
(b)     A $200.00 fee for a vacant structure that is on the vacant structure registry for at least one year but less than two consecutive years;
(c)      A $400.00 fee for a property that is on the vacant structure registry for at least two consecutive years but less than three consecutive years;
(d)     A $600.00 fee for a property that is on the vacant structure registry for at least three consecutive years but less than four consecutive years;

(e)     A $800.00 fee for a property that is on the vacant structure registry for at least four consecutive years but less than five consecutive years; and
(f)      A $1,600 fee for a property that is on the vacant structure registry for at least five consecutive years, plus an additional $300 for each year in excess of five years.
The proposed code may be viewed in its entirety in advance of the Public Hearing at Ronceverte City Hall.  The Council will consider adoption of the proposed code following the hearing and second reading.
